USA: rise in weekly jobless claims


(CercleFinance.com) – Weekly jobless claims increased the week of July 4 in the United States, standing at 244,000, against 235,000 (revised figure) the previous week, according to figures from the Department of Labor.

The four-week moving average – which can be seen as a better indicator of the underlying labor market trend – also came out higher, at 235,750 from 232,750 a week earlier.

Finally, the number of people regularly receiving benefits amounted to 1,331,000 during the week of June 27 (i.e. the last week for which these figures are available), which represents a drop of 41,000 compared to the revised figure. of the previous week.
